# Chalkline timetable solver — release configuration
#
# Release manager: verify every value in this block before tagging
# a build. The solver-depth and room-capacity settings are frozen
# for this cycle; any change requires sign-off from the Ferranti
# scheduling group. Note that the staging and production clusters
# use different credentials, so confirm the target environment
# carefully. The solver connects to its constraint database using
# the string defined on the following line.

replica DSN, kajep-yahag: mssql://praok_svc:iF@db-8d68.plorvaio.local:5432/eliion

# Break-Glass: Catalog Cache Invalidation

Scope: the Pinrow product catalog at Veldstone Retail. If stale prices persist after a purge and the Hollowmere invalidation queue is wedged, use break-glass to flush the edge tier directly. Contractors: get verbal sign-off from the catalog lead first. Steps: open the Hollowmere admin shell, select emergency-flush, confirm the tenant, and run it once — repeated flushes thrash the origin. Access is logged and expires after 20 minutes. Unseal the admin shell with the passphrase below.

recovery phrase for kahop-tajog: istix-casvan

Franchise Agreement — Harlow & Trett Coffee Houses (Managers Only)

This page summarises the proposed franchise agreement with Dunmoor Hospitality covering twelve sites across the Caldvale region. Royalty terms, fit-out standards, and a five-year renewal option have been agreed in principle. Board approval is required before signature. Directors should review the confidential context appended below.

confidential, kagup-bafog: Fraaxax Group is in early talks to buy Soroxox Group for about $343.8 million. The Olidor launch date is June 14, and nothing goes to the press before then. Legal wants the Aldmirek Logistics term sheet signed before July 23.